Top 5 First Person Games in Bahrain Q4 2025: Performance Insights

In the fourth quarter of 2025, the first person gaming category in Bahrain witnessed notable trends across the top five games on a unified platform, combining data from both iOS and Android. This analysis is powered by Sensor Tower.

Call of Duty®: Mobile from Activision Publishing, Inc. showed a fluctuating revenue pattern, starting at around $6.4K and dipping to $1.9K by early December, before climbing back to $5.6K in the final week. Downloads remained relatively stable, peaking at 772 in mid-December.

Minecraft: Dream it, Build it! by Mojang experienced moderate revenue growth towards the end of the quarter, reaching $613. Weekly downloads saw a similar trend, with a high of 119 in early December.

Hunting Sniper : Safari from SPARKS INFORMATION (SINGAPORE) PTE. LTD. had a varied revenue stream throughout the quarter, peaking at $287 in mid-December. Downloads declined gradually, closing the quarter at 75.

Blackjack 21: Blackjackist by KamaGames saw an upward trend in revenue, culminating at $285 in the last week of December. Downloads were relatively low, with a slight increase to 40 in late December.

Critical Strike CS: Online FPS from VERTIGOGAMES had a revenue spike to $451 in mid-October, with a steady decline thereafter, ending at $181. Downloads fluctuated mildly, peaking at 127 in early December.
